For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Graduate Schools In Minnesota Colleges is 75.83%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 24.12%. A total of 59,743 have applied, 45,302 admitted, and 10,928 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Graduate Schools In Minnesota Colleges.
Minnesota State University-Mankato is the tightest school to admit with 70.68% acceptance rate, and University of Minnesota-Twin Cities has the second lowest acceptance rate of 74.91%.
